MSA: Standalone Coded Non Contact Safety Switch (Stainless Steel 316)

  • The MSA is a standalone, non contact safety switch with its own internal monitoring system that uses two force guided mechanical contacts, maintaining PLe/Cat4 (ISO13849-1) even when switches are connected in series.

  • They can be mounted to guard doors to provide and maintain a high level of functional safety without the need to connect to a safety monitoring device such as a safety relay or PLC.


The MSA is housed in a mirror polished stainless steel 316 housing (Ra4) and can be used in virtually any environment including high pressure cleaning following contamination from foreign particles. The housings are compact and easy to fit on less than 40mm frame sections.

Dual Actuator versions are also available for use with “double door” guards. The typical sensing distance “on” is 12mm with wide tolerance to guard misalignment after setting.

All standalone switches employ 2 Force Guided Mechanical Relays and incorporate internal checking to ensure both relays are operational after each safety demand. If one relay fails to open or becomes inoperative the switch will lock out safe.

Features
Material: 316 Stainless Steel, Ra4 Mirror Polished
Feedback circuit check option is included for use when incorporating reset buttons and external contactor feedback checks
Contacts: 2 N/C Safety + 1 N/O Auxiliary (Volt Free)
Output Rating: 3A at 24VDC/240Vac
Ingress Protection: IP69K
Connection: Pre-Wired or M12 8 Pole Quick Connect (QC)
